Wings edge Fever 107-104 as Clark shines in season debut

TL;DR Summary
Dallas Wings edged the Indiana Fever 107-104 in the season opener at Gainbridge Fieldhouse. Caitlin Clark scored 20 with seven assists and five rebounds in her long-awaited WNBA debut, while Kelsey Mitchell paced Indiana with 30 points. Dallas shot 39-for-66 to Indiana’s 40-for-77, pushing the Fever to play at the Wings’ pace; a late push fell short when Mitchell’s last-second 3 rimmed out. Halftime stood at 60-51 Wings, and Indiana’s next game is May 13 at the Los Angeles Sparks.
